Din Tai Fung (鼎泰豐) Festive Specials Available From 17 January 2014 plus Giveaway of Smoked Salmon Yu Sheng

[Din Tai Fung] Abalone Fortune Yu Sheng
From now till 28 February 2014, Din Tai Fung (鼎泰豐) is pleased to introduce a line-up of Lunar New Year specials which is available for dine-in or takeaway. And during this festive season, everyone loves to toss an auspicious New Year with Yu Sheng (鱼生) that brings healthy and prosperity for the new year.

Din Tai Fung (鼎泰豐) offers two different types of Yu Sheng such as:-
Salmon Prosperity Yu Sheng (富贵鱼生)
- Standard (serves 2 - 3 pax) @ SG$28.80++
- Deluxe (serves 4 - 6 pax) @ SG$48.80++
* Available at all outlets except Din Tai Fung at Parkway Parade

 Abalone Fortune Yu Sheng ( 财宝鱼生)
- Deluxe (serves 4 - 6 pax) @ SG$68.80++
* Available at Din Tai Fung at Paragon, Marina Bay Sands, Resort World Sentosa, Marina Bay Link Mall, BreadTalk IHQ and Raffles City only

Goodness of Beetroot

For those who dislike the “raw” taste of beetroot you can mix it together with carrot and apple to create this miracle drink which has gained popularity all over the world due to its health benefit. To make this effortless juice, blend the three mentioned ingredients above together and consume it immediately. In addition you can also add in a splash of lime juice to enhance the taste.

[Photo Friday] Dayre - My New Daily Posts

[DAYRE] - A microblog on mobile app
Recently I am hook on "Dayre" which is a new mobile app that allows user to blog on the go without turning out the PC or Laptop. You can easily download this FREE App which available on iPhone and Android and start your first step of blogging anytime of the day using your mobile phone.

This app is great with short post (about 500 characters each post) which enable for user to share their daily encounters, views and etc with the unlimited numbers of media like quotes, photos, videos, stickers and location check-in.

Shortbread is one of my favourite cookies to enjoy with a cup of freshly brewed tea and in order to make some good quality of shortbread it is very important to use quality butter and pure vanilla extract to enhance the taste. Furthermore you can have different flavour and texture by adding cocoa powder, espresso powder or lemon zest plus a small amount of cornflour to the all-purpose flour to achieve that melt-in-your-mouth shortbread.
